Who this course is for?
Whether you've never heard of « Les pronoms relatifs » before, or you've studied them  but still don't master their correct usage quiet confidently, this course is absolutely for you. The level of French used to explain the lessons suits learners whose French is between A2 & B2, according to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CECRL). 

What you'll learn
The spoken language in all 5 videos is French and only French, therefore you will be learning a lot. So, get your notebook ready!
You'll learn how to use les pronoms où - qui - que - dont, and you will be able to answer the following two questions for each pronoun: 

  1. What word does the pronoun replace?
  2. Where to place the pronoun in the sentence?
